For advanced workflows, VJs often need to route video between different applications (e.g., from TouchDesigner or MadMapper into Resolume). macOS uses , an open-source Mac technology that allows applications to share real-time video frames almost instantly. Syphon operates directly on the GPU, making it faster and more stable than network-based video sharing protocols. Reliable Clamshell Mode
